Remember a time when houses were built to a standard, not to a budget? At 75 Elinor Bell you will find a bespoke, architect-designed home boasting high quality craftsman details and features. In 1992 the original and current owners commissioned the construction of this house to surround themselves in the charms of yesteryear but to also enjoy the practicality of modern-day living. Award-winning architect Clem Mitchell was given the task of creating a Federation style residence, designing a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om masterpiece with a total living area measuring 296m2.
There are 3 living areas, a formal dining area plus meals area off the kitchen and a dedicated study. Being a multi level design, the different areas of the home are emphasised according to floor level. The raised formal dining area at the front of the house is emphasised by the adjoining sunken formal lounge. Genuine timber floors grace this area as do tasteful archways and a functional fireplace. The owners purchased a extensive list of quality items from Subiaco Restorations during the building process and the beautiful cornices and ceiling roses are evidence of this. The many gorgeous lead lights that feature through the house date back to the early 1900s and add to the character that abounded with turn-of-the-century living.
The size of Leschenault is approximately 43.5 square kilometres. It has 8 parks covering nearly 29.9% of total area. The population of Leschenault in 2016 was 2932 people. By 2021 the population was 3058 showing a population growth of 4.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Leschenault is 60-69 years. Households in Leschenault are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Leschenault work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 92.30% of the homes in Leschenault were owner-occupied compared with 91.20% in 2016.
Leschenault has 1,178 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Leschenault have seen a 88.23%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 198.03% increase. As at 30 November 2025:
